Detection Tips for Press Releases

  • 1AI press releases use generic executive quotes that lack personality or specific strategic vision
  • 2Check for boilerplate company descriptions that could apply to any firm in the industry
  • 3AI-generated releases often miss timely market context and competitive positioning details
